Output 64bb6f17f86b8a88789806db619d3bed6596370bd73a13d93c7f091f4d48f383:1

value
431731476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b7e9059760e7282dadc8a58fa51412b3fb0cc7 OP_EQUAL
address
3CEswuqjVXufPYjyAjMjAZrZgYA3G7Nopj
transaction
64bb6f17f86b8a88789806db619d3bed6596370bd73a13d93c7f091f4d48f383
spent
true